Welcome to the new home of the Cumulus Support forum.

Latest Cumulus release v1.9.4 (build 1099) - Nov 28 2014
Latest Cumulus MX release - v3.0.0 build 3043 Jan 20 2017. See the Wiki for download

Ajax Dashboard - days since rain

Discussion of Ken True's web site templates

Moderator: saratogaWX

Post Reply
tcsplinters
Posts: 13
Joined: Wed Dec 17, 2014 6:44 am
Weather Station: Fine Offset
Operating System: Win 7
Location: Tasman

Ajax Dashboard - days since rain

Post by tcsplinters » Thu Dec 07, 2017 6:08 pm

Hi

After having a small moment yesterday with erroneous rain data... I have managed to fix all the faulty data except in the wxindex / ajax dashboard.

I am trying to find where the days since last rain is generated from... because it would appear I have an error in my data

www.jointworks.co.nz/weather/wxindex.php

Currently showing 17507, should be around 24

Thank you

BCJKiwi
Posts: 868
Joined: Mon Jul 09, 2012 8:40 pm
Weather Station: Davis VP2 Cabled with Solar
Operating System: Windows 10 Pro
Location: Auckland, New Zealand
Contact:

Re: Ajax Dashboard - days since rain

Post by BCJKiwi » Thu Dec 07, 2017 7:45 pm

As far as I can see from a quick look;
This is based on the LastRrainTipISO value from Cumulus and calculated by the Saratoga template file CU-defs.php which creates the $dayswithnorain variable used in ajax-dashboard.php
Search for $dayswithnorain in CU-defs.php

tcsplinters
Posts: 13
Joined: Wed Dec 17, 2014 6:44 am
Weather Station: Fine Offset
Operating System: Win 7
Location: Tasman

Re: Ajax Dashboard - days since rain

Post by tcsplinters » Fri Dec 08, 2017 6:21 pm

Hi

Thanks for this. Yes it is in the CU-Defs file

So CU-Defs.php reads from CU_tags.php

However cant find where that lasttipdate is set within Cumulus in order to set it in the CU_tags file. Manually corrected it with Cumulus shutdown, but Cumulus overwrote it once it restarted

Thanks in advance
tc

BCJKiwi
Posts: 868
Joined: Mon Jul 09, 2012 8:40 pm
Weather Station: Davis VP2 Cabled with Solar
Operating System: Windows 10 Pro
Location: Auckland, New Zealand
Contact:

Re: Ajax Dashboard - days since rain

Post by BCJKiwi » Fri Dec 08, 2017 7:26 pm

The starting point is this entry;
$LastRainTipISO = '<#LastRainTipISO>';
in the CUtagsT.txt template file in the C:\cumulus\web folder

If you look at this value in either;
CUtagsT.txttmp in C:\cumulus\web folder
or
the CUtags.php file on the webserver you should see the value Cumulus is delivering.
If this is not correct then there is still an error somewhere that needs to be fixed in the cumulus data.

User avatar
steve
Cumulus Author
Posts: 26713
Joined: Mon Jun 02, 2008 6:49 pm
Weather Station: None
Operating System: None
Location: Vienne, France
Contact:

Re: Ajax Dashboard - days since rain

Post by steve » Fri Dec 08, 2017 7:48 pm

The last rain tip time is held in today.ini and you can change it by stopping Cumulus and editing that file.
Steve

tcsplinters
Posts: 13
Joined: Wed Dec 17, 2014 6:44 am
Weather Station: Fine Offset
Operating System: Win 7
Location: Tasman

Re: Ajax Dashboard - days since rain

Post by tcsplinters » Sat Dec 09, 2017 6:26 am

Hi

Thanks to you both. That solved it... learnt a fair bit about the file son the way through as well

thx

Post Reply